Subject: Snapfold cut-over complete. We moved all UI component snapshot tests from the Greybarrow runner to Lintrel last night. Baselines were regenerated once, reviewed by the Welkin squad, and locked. Future maintainers should regenerate only per-component, never fleet-wide. The runner now operates with the configuration values given below.

service settings:
[quenath]
host = quenath.zemvarcorp.corp
user = quenath_svc
database = quenath_prod

New Starter Checklist — Item 6: Basement Archive Orientation

On your first day, visit the archive room in the basement of Fenwick Court with your team buddy. Note the fire exit locations and the no-food rule — paper records are stored on open shelving. Records can only be removed with a sign-out slip from the tray by the door. The keypad entry on the archive door uses the starter code provided here.

staff pass of kagup-fajog = bdg-QCHVQW-99665837

Scope: delivery of uniform sets for the new Norcliff depot, shipped in sealed cartons from Braydon Outfitting.

Receiving: count cartons against the manifest before signing. Do not break seals at the dock; cartons go straight to the stores cage. Any damaged or unsealed carton is refused and logged.

Timing: deliveries arrive between 07:00 and 09:00, weekdays only. The stores keeper must be present; no unattended drop-offs.

For the accompanying document pouch, apply the hand-over instruction below.

handover note for yagef-bagep: the drudor pelius courier leaves the kasdor zorvan norir ledger at gate 8016 under passcode 755406

Minutes — Management Meeting

Topic: Project Larkspan delay. The rollout slips eight weeks due to vendor integration issues at the Norbury site. Interim workarounds approved; branch reporting continues on the legacy system. Budget impact assessed as minor. Branch managers to brief staff by Friday. Next review in three weeks. The strategic note follows below.

internal memo for kawip-hadug: Headcount on the Wenwyn team goes from 7 to 140 by the end of January. Gross margin on Wenwyn came in at 20 percent against a plan of 15 percent.